The Edakkal caves are two natural caves at a remote location at Edakkal, 25 km from Kalpetta in the Wayanad district of Kerala in India.
Edakkal Caves is an enchanting site with archaeological importance. It’s known for its mystic rock formation and ancient drawings and engravings. And these petroglyphs are some of the earliest examples of human writing and expression.
Edakkal means “a stone in between.” And this cave-like rock shelter is formed by a massive boulder wedged between two bigger boulders. It’s believed to exist for over 8,000 years now.
To reach the entrance of Edakkal Caves Wayanad, you need to trek up and climb steep steps. Inside, you'll see ancient wall carvings, which depict animals, humans and other figures from prehistoric times.
Edakkal Caves is worth a visit also for the breathtaking scenery. The drive to the caves, the trekking, and the views of the countryside from the top make up for a wholesome trip
